Joss is back!  
To write and direct Avengers 2. Not a big surprise, but they just made it official. Per MTV.com, he's also going to be developing a  TV show for ABC set in the Marvel Cinematic Universe (MCU), and so far the wild speculation is as follows:


The exact specifics of that show — title, focus, cast of characters — are entirely under wraps, though it's been said that it could be "a high-concept cop show," leading many to believe that it's a S.H.I.E.L.D. focused television series.
